Warnings:
Warming Up
Riders must not warm up past the start and finish areas.
No parking at the start or finish and vehicles must NOT be parked, however briefly, in any part of the access area to Mount Pleasant Nursing Home, opposite the finish.
Riders must not stop at the FINISH but continue along the A50 back to the HQ at Goostrey where times will be displayed.
Care at Road Junctions
Riders must exercise caution at all junctions. Any competitor whose riding line causes him/her to cross the white line when approaching or leaving a junction will be disqualified from the event and may be reported to the District Committee for further disciplinary action Any rider making a U turn in the vicinity of the start or finish will be disqualified.
Please ride with your head up at all times. Ride a safe distance from the kerb, but do not ride out in the traffic. Observers are being used in this event
Chelford Island:
Riders must negotiate Chelford Island in a safe and sensible manner in accordance with CTT Reg.20 and the rules of the road. Riders must be able to brake and stop at the island if traffic conditions require this. Riders MUST NOT approach and encircle the island using tri-bars. Remember that traffic on the island has priority over traffic (including riders) entering it. Any rider seen to be in breach of this regulation will be disqualified from the event and may be reported for further disciplinary action.
Riders must take extra care when exiting from Seven Sisters Lane onto the A50 Be aware that there is a double bend shortly after turning into Twemlow lane at Cranage. Riders need to anticipate this and be prepared to negotiate it in a safe manner. In wet weather the metal covers and edges become a skid risk. Please take care.
IN THE INTERESTS OF YOUR OWN SAFETY, Cycling Time Trials and the event promoters strongly advise you to wear a HARD SHELL HELMET that meets an internationally accepted safety. In accordance with Regulation 15 ALL JUNIOR & JUVENILE competitors must wear Protective Hard Shell Helmets
It is recommended that a working rear light, either flashing or constant, is fitted to the machine in a position visible to following road users and is active whilst the machine is in use.
